In 1989, Ambassador Baptist College officially began with a “Remove Not the Ancient Landmark Conference.” The speakers were Dr. Lee Roberson, Dr. Tom Malone, Dr. Ralph Sexton, Sr., and Dr. Harold Sightler. At the time, each of these men had been preaching more than 50 years. Thus, a foundation emphasizing the importance of preaching was firmly laid.

Every summer, Camp Barnabas is held simultaneously with the Landmark Conference. This summer ministry camp is designed for teenagers in grades 7-12 who are either called to full-time Christian service or are seriously considering it. Teenagers from twelve different states joined us for an exciting week of ministry workshops and preaching. Evangelist David Cajiuat from Hazel Green, AL, preached to the campers throughout the week. His messages stirred the teens to see the need for godly character in this wicked world.

The highlight of the week was the Preachers Symposium that was held on Thursday afternoon. For more than two hours, eighteen preachers fielded questions from other preachers and those in the audience. Each of these men had been in the ministry for more than fifty years.
